The cost of a key may vary dependent on the model and year as well as whether or you own a remote-lock. Certain keys are more advanced than others and require a transponder chip which needs to be programmed into the vehicle in order to start the engine. A professional from the Dublin northside repair shop for car parts and repairs stated that a typical replacement for an older car is about EUR50 and up, however some high-end models can cost up to EUR500 if the key is part of a remote-lock system. You will need to replace the key fob, as well an ignition and transponder chip. A traditional car key features an elongated key that folds into the fob similar to a switchblade, and it's simple to replace. A modern “smart key” requires a proximity sensor to unlock the doors and start the car. This makes it more expensive to replace. Avoiding panic There's no need to worry when you lose your car keys.
